Tor Arne Vestbø 919f514f29 macOS: Don't scroll individual rects of a region when inline scrolling
The QPlatformBackingStore::scroll() API takes a QRegion as input, and we
kept this data type in the implementation of QCALayerBackingStore::scroll
for the logic of figuring out whether we could use the existing back
buffer as source of the scroll or if we needed to pull data from the
front buffer.

We then iterated the rects of the resulting in-line region, and called
qt_scrollRectInImage for each of them. This will unfortunately not work
whenever the scroll of one of these rects ends up overwriting parts of
the back buffer that later rects of the region use as their source rect.

This could be reproduced by moving the cursor within a text document,
which would dirty a small area around the cursor, making the subsequent
scroll of the viewport result in garbled text.

This issue exists in the other platform backingstore implementations
too, but since the QWidgetRepaintManager never calls scroll() with
anything but a single rect they would not have any issues.

The problem could potentially be solved by sorting the rects before
blitting them, but now this quick fix solves the regression on macOS.

André de la Rocha 4114a0ea75 Windows QPA: Fix slowdown with large table/tree views with accessibility
The accessibility code for notifying focus changes related to a
table/tree view was iterating over all items to find the focused one,
which for a very large number of items could cause a major slowdown
and UI freeze. This patch avoids the issue by removing the loop and
implementing the focusChild() method in the table/tree accessibility
classes.

Volker Hilsheimer 999d856bc8 Adapt SQL drivers to Qt 6 change of QVariant::isNull
In Qt 5, QVariant::isNull returned true if either the variant didn't
contain a value, or if the value was of a nullable type where the type's
isNull member function returned true.

In Qt 6, QVariant::isNull only returns true for variants that don't
contain a value; if the value contained is e.g. a null-QString or
QDateTime, then QVariant::isNull  returns false.

This change requires a follow up in the SQL drivers, which must
still treat null-values the same as null-variants, lest they write data
into the data base.

Add a static helper to QSqlResultPrivate that implements isNull-checking
of variants that contain a nullable type relevant for Sql, and add a
test case to the QSqlQuery test that exercises that code.

Volker Hilsheimer 4bee9cdc0a macOS: Fix QSlider's knob positioning on Monterey
QMacStyle has a single NSSlider that is used to render any QSlider. For
each QStyle API operating on a slider, the style sets the slider up with
respecive properties. On macOS 12, the NSSlider maintains some states
that make QSlider instances influence each other's knob position when
rendering, resulting in uncontrollable jumping of the slider.

This can be fixed by not using startTrackingAt/stopTracking APIs, which
are however the only way we have to make the slider knob get rendered
pressed - there is no property in NSSlider(Cell), and none of the NSCell
attributes have any effect. So we need to use startTrackingAt, and work
around the side effect by reinitializing the NSSlider by calling
initWithFrame.

This fixes the positioning error, but also causes flickering of the knob
when dragging. To fix the flickering, we have to always call
startTrackingAt for a slider that is pressed, even for calls to
setupSlider that are made in QStyle APIs that are not drawing anything.

Also tried with no complete success (either positiong bug or flicker):
* call prepareForReuse on the NSView
* always call stopTracking on the NSSlider

Tor Arne Vestbø 5190e77d87 macOS: Track painted area of backingstore buffer via its dirty region
When introducing support for scrolling the backingstore it doesn't make
sense to track the painted region explicitly.

Pick-to: 6.2
Change-Id: I370932f02490ac526fb049908f99af678884e807
Reviewed-by: Timur Pocheptsov <timur.pocheptsov@qt.io>
2021-11-08 19:04:59 +01:00
Tor Arne Vestbø 38130406ca macOS: Don't defer back/front-buffer swap in CALayer backingstore
CoreAnimation doesn't immediately mark a surface as in use the moment
we assign it to a layer, but defers it until the surface has bee picked
up by the window server. In theory this would allow us to defer the swap
until the next beginPaint(), which would allow painting to the back buffer
again before Core Animation has time to flush the transaction and persist
the layer changes to the window server, and would also automatically deal
with requests to flush without painting anything.

But, since a client may do several rounds of beginPaint/endPaint before
flushing, we might end up in a situation where we detect that a surface
is in use in the middle of several paint rounds, and end up swapping in
a new back buffer without copying over the previously painted content,
like we do in prepareForFlush. To be on the safe side we swap the back
and front buffer straight away.

We also need to mark the surface in use, to prevent the same problem
from appearing when the window server doesn't pick up the surface in
between two rounds of flushes.

Lars Knoll 28138aa80a Fix show()/hide() for child windows on xcb
Change e946e6895a implements proper
support for ICCM 4.1.4 window state handling. One issue it addressed
is that a show() after a hide() needs to be delayed until the window
manager/X-server has processed the previous event.

This was handled with a deferred task list to send the map/unmap
events. According to ICCM, we should wait for the _NET_WM_STATE
notification before processing the deferred events.

But this is only true for top level windows, as child windows are
not handled by the window manager and will never receive any
_NET_WM_STATE notifications. For those, we should use the unmap
notify event, which means that the X-server has processed the unmap
and handle deferred events once that notification has been received.

This fixes an issue in Qt Multimedia, where QVideoWidget would not
show the video anymore after a minimize of the player or when making
the QVideoWidget fullscreen. This is because QVideoWidget uses an
embedded QWindow to render video using HW acceleration.

Andreas Buhr a47f66cee2 Android: Fix handling of cursor position when stop composing
This is a workaround for a problem in TextEdit.
The symptom is that when the user places the cursor inside
of a word and hits backspace, the last letter of the word
is removed instead of the letter just before the cursor.
The reason is as follows.
When stopping composing, the current cursor position has to
be maintained. To that end, QAndroidInputContext sends an
event containing the text to be committed and the cursor position
to the editor. But the resulting cursor position is wrong.
This patch adapts QAndroidInputContext to send two events:
One to commit the text, the second to place the cursor.
A real fix would fix the editor to correctly
handle the event containing both the committed text and
the cursor position.
